Origin
The Yorkshire Terrier was born in the 19th century of England during the Industrial Revolution, when workers in coal mines, textile mills and factories needed small dogs to control the rats in the area. Yorkies are the result of careful breeding. They are distinguished by their appearance and a feisty personality. Their bravery is what makes them popular in many households today.

Characteristics
Yorkies are incredibly affectionate and spirited dogs. They are extremely intelligent and awe-inspiring which makes them easy to train. However, they have an innate independence and are sometimes fierce. They require plenty of exercise, but also love and affection from their owners. They make good companions for people who live alone or in households with older kids. Their small size makes them excellent apartment dwellers.
Although Yorkies make very good companions for humans but they can be a bit suspicious of strangers and may bark at them. Yorkies can also be susceptible to health problems, such as heart disease, so they must receive regular vet visits and be given regular exercise and a healthy diet.

Yorkies are susceptible to degenerative hip conditions which can cause pain and lameness on either or both rear legs. A veterinarian can diagnose the condition with X-rays, or a physical examination. Certain Yorkies may also be susceptible to Von Willebrand disease, an blood clotting disorder that is inherited. Your veterinarian can use a DNA test to identify this condition, as well as any other genetic bleeding disorder in your pet.
Appearance
Yorkies have a silky, fine coat that is hypoallergenic and comparable to human hair. The deep tan color of their limbs and faces are complemented by the dark gray to black on their rears. Yorkies are popular due to their distinctive appearance. This gorgeous coat requires regular grooming, regardless of whether or not you intend to show off your Yorkie.
In addition to defining the breed's distinctive appearance, the breed standard serves many other important purposes. It helps breeders produce dogs that meet the standards, and it assists judges in evaluating Yorkies in conformation contests.
The breed standard states that Yorkies should be small and compact dogs. They should have a graceful and well-balanced body that is in harmony with their height. Their heads should be slim and slightly flat on the top. Their noses should have a nice shape and depth and be dark. The eyes should be dark, sparkling, and have an intelligent look. Their ears should be small, V-shaped, carried erect, and set a little apart.
Yorkshire Terriers should have a black mouth and either a scissor bite or a level bite (incisor teeth that meet but do not overlap). The tail should be proportional to the rest of the dog's body. The nails must be smooth and short.

Care Tip #2: Practice good dental hygiene.
Yorkies are prone to dental problems due to their small size. Regular brushing of the teeth with a specific pet toothbrush and toothpaste can to prevent the accumulation of tartar and plaque, which can lead to gum tissue inflammation and tooth decay. Regular dental cleanings under anesthesia help evaluate the health of your pet's mouth and treat or remove poor teeth.
Clovis yorkshire terrier kaufen Terriers are also prone to eye issues such as lens luxation and insufficient tear production. Both of these are hereditary and require surgery to treat. They may also suffer a painful hip condition called Legg-Calve-Perthes that is caused by a decreased blood supply to the head of the femoral bone in one or both hind legs. This condition is usually seen in puppies and requires surgery to correct it. Keep your ears clean by cleaning them every 2-4 week to avoid infections and debris.
Feeding
For the first few weeks, it is recommended to make use of a high-quality canine replacement milk to ensure your puppy gets all the nutrients it needs to maintain its health and growth.
Once your puppy has been fully weaned, you can begin feeding them regular meals rather than free-feeding. Puppy puppies require three to four small meals a day morning afternoon (or evening if they're feeding four meals) and at night. They may need small snacks in between meals as well.
As the puppies grow into adults, their energy requirements will change, and they'll require a switch from an incredibly protein-rich diet to one that's lower in fat. Adult Yorkies benefit from a mix of canned and dry food. A high-quality food should contain many proteins to meet the nutritional needs of your puppy as well as low-fat carbohydrate sources such as fruits and vegetables to provide them with essential fiber.
Your adult Yorkshire Terrier must be fed three times per day. You can feed them a mix of canned and dry food in their regular meals and offer them small snacks all day.
Make it gradual if you are changing the dog's diet. Start by mixing old and new food in 1:1 over a period of five days. Do a 1 to 3 ratio for the next 5 days. Then gradually reduce the amount of old food and increase the new.
The best way to determine the amount your dog should be eating is to weigh them. You can use a household scale or ask your vet to weigh it for you.
